1. Automate Repetitive Tasks
One of the most effective ways to boost productivity is by automating repetitive tasks. These tasks often consume a significant amount of time and can be easily automated using the right tools. For example, you can automate data entry, email responses, and appointment scheduling. By doing so, you free up valuable time for more critical activities.
2. Utilize Workflow Automation
Workflow automation involves creating a series of automated actions that complete a process. This strategy is particularly useful for complex processes that involve multiple steps and departments. Tools like Zapier and Microsoft Power Automate can help you set up automated workflows, ensuring that tasks are completed efficiently and accurately.
3. Implement Marketing Automation
Marketing automation can significantly enhance your marketing efforts by automating tasks such as email marketing, social media posting, and lead nurturing. Platforms like HubSpot and Mail chimp offer comprehensive automation features that can help you reach your target audience more effectively and improve your marketing ROI.
4. Enhance Customer Service with Chatbots
Integrating chatbots into your customer service strategy can greatly improve efficiency and customer satisfaction. Chabot’s can handle a wide range of customer queries, provide instant responses, and escalate issues to human agents when necessary. This not only saves time but also ensures that customers receive timely and accurate support.
5. Streamline Financial Processes
Automation can also be applied to financial processes such as invoicing, expense tracking, and payroll management. Tools like QuickBooks and Xero offer robust automation features that can help you manage your finances more efficiently and reduce the risk of errors.

What is Enterprise Application Integration?
Tumblr media
As your business grows, you’ll be accumulating a good amount of software. ERP software, CRM products and analytics platforms are but a few examples. As your technology landscape evolves, you must ensure that the information in each of these systems work collaboratively.
Communication among software is necessary. Disparate information stored in silos won’t do you much good. That’s why we have integration technologies. Middleware like SAP PO and SAP CPI, or integration tools developed for specific applications, ensure that data from all your systems can communicate. This way, your information is synched and up to date. Your enterprise’s cumulative data can be used for streamlining business processes and gaining predictive insight.
Why is Enterprise Application Integration Important?
Without EAI, an enterprise’s information would be stored in silos. Whatever data collected through an application would exist solely in that system. This inaccessibility to information by other software systems would lead to extremely inefficient business processes and slow down administrative work.
A lack of EAI or middleware would result in the following disruptions:
Modifications made to data wouldn’t reflect onto other systems, meaning a single modification would need to be repeated for each application.
Transferring acquired data from one application to another would have to be entirely manual.
Functionalities from different applications couldn’t be combined for workflows.
Enterprise Application Integration addresses three important needs.
Seamless Data Exchange
Enterprise Integration Software allows information flow between different systems, leading to seamless business processes and a uniform overview of enterprise data. It also enhances data availability within the enterprise, which minimizes errors caused by miscommunication.
Access Through a Single Interface
EAI allows the possibility of accessing multiple applications from a single platform. Rather than learning and adjusting to several application interfaces, you can access all your enterprise data through Product Automation and Integration. Like accessing your Salesforce data and Amazon S3 files directly from your SAP CPI platform using CPI Burger adapters.
Vendor Independence
EAI promotes vendor independence. By shifting your business processes into Automate & Integration framework, you’ll have freedom to change or remove applications without disrupting your ecosystem. Your applications will support your business rules, not the other way around.

What Is Smart Automation?
Smart automation refers to the integration of advanced technologies such as artificial intelligence (AI), machine learning, and data analytics into automation processes. Unlike traditional automation, which focuses on executing predefined tasks, smart automation involves systems that can learn from data, make decisions, and continuously improve their performance. This intelligent approach enhances the effectiveness and adaptability of automation solutions.
The Benefits of Smart Automation
Enhanced Efficiency and Productivity Smart automation optimizes processes by intelligently managing workflows and resources. AI-driven systems can analyze vast amounts of data in real-time, making adjustments that enhance efficiency and productivity. For example, smart manufacturing systems can automatically adjust production schedules based on real-time demand and equipment performance.
Improved Decision-Making With advanced data analytics and machine learning, smart automation provides actionable insights that drive better decision-making. By analyzing patterns and trends, these systems can offer predictive insights, optimize strategies, and mitigate risks, leading to more informed and strategic business decisions.
Personalized Customer Experiences Smart automation enables highly personalized interactions with customers. AI-powered chatbots and recommendation engines analyze customer behavior and preferences to deliver tailored experiences and solutions. This level of personalization enhances customer satisfaction and loyalty, driving long-term business success.
Sustainability and Resource Efficiency Intelligent automation contributes to sustainability by optimizing resource use and reducing waste. For instance, smart energy management systems can monitor and adjust energy consumption in real-time, leading to significant savings and a lower environmental impact.
Enhanced Safety and Reliability Smart automation systems improve safety and reliability by monitoring conditions and detecting anomalies. In industries such as healthcare and manufacturing, these systems can predict and prevent equipment failures, ensuring safe and uninterrupted operations.
Applications of Smart Automation
Healthcare In healthcare, smart automation enhances patient care through advanced diagnostics, personalized treatment plans, and efficient administrative processes. AI algorithms analyze medical data to assist in early diagnosis, while automated systems manage patient records and scheduling with high accuracy.
Manufacturing Smart automation in manufacturing involves the use of robots, sensors, and AI to streamline production processes. Intelligent systems can manage supply chains, predict maintenance needs, and optimize production schedules, leading to increased efficiency and reduced downtime.
Finance In the financial sector, smart automation supports fraud detection, risk management, and customer service. AI algorithms analyze transaction patterns to detect anomalies, while automated systems handle routine tasks such as transaction processing and report generation.
Retail Retailers use smart automation to enhance inventory management, personalize marketing campaigns, and optimize supply chains. AI-driven systems analyze customer data to tailor promotions and improve the shopping experience, while automated inventory systems ensure that stock levels are efficiently managed.
Transportation and Logistics Smart automation in transportation and logistics includes autonomous vehicles, route optimization, and real-time tracking. These technologies improve efficiency, reduce costs, and enhance the reliability of supply chain operations.

Metal Parts Reciprocating Automatic Spraying Line
The metal parts reciprocating automatic spraying line is designed for efficient coating of hardware products. It adopts advanced reciprocating spraying technology to achieve uniform coverage and high-quality spraying effect. The system realizes the automatic spraying process through intelligent control, greatly improving production efficiency and coating accuracy. The coating line is equipped with a precise spray gun positioning system and adjustment function to ensure that the surface of each metal part can obtain a uniform and durable coating. At the same time, the system also has efficient drying and exhaust gas treatment functions to ensure the cleanliness and safety of the production environment. What Are Control Integration Services?
Control Integration Services focus on integrating diverse control systems into a single, cohesive framework. Whether it's industrial automation, building management, or IT infrastructure, CIS ensure that various systems—such as process control systems, building management systems (BMS), and IT management tools—work together seamlessly. The primary objective is to create an integrated platform that enhances system communication, streamlines operations, and provides comprehensive real-time data.
Key Benefits of Control Integration Services
Increased Operational Efficiency: Integrating control systems into one unified platform simplifies operations, reduces duplication of efforts, and minimizes manual interventions. This leads to significant cost savings and more efficient use of resources, ultimately boosting productivity.
Enhanced Accuracy and Precision: With real-time data and analytics from integrated systems, organizations can make more informed decisions. This improves the precision of operations and reduces errors, leading to better overall performance.
Centralized Monitoring and Management: Control Integration Services provide a centralized interface for monitoring and managing all integrated systems. This centralization facilitates easier oversight and quicker issue resolution, enhancing operational control.
Scalability and Flexibility: Integrated control systems offer scalability and adaptability to changing business needs. Whether expanding operations or upgrading technology, CIS allow for the seamless integration of new systems and technologies.
Improved Security: A unified approach to system integration enhances security by providing a consolidated view of system activities and access controls. This helps in identifying and mitigating potential security threats more effectively.
Core Components of Control Integration Services
System Assessment and Planning: Successful integration begins with a detailed assessment of existing systems. This involves evaluating current control technologies, identifying integration gaps, and developing a strategic integration plan.
Integration Architecture Design: Designing an effective integration architecture involves selecting appropriate technologies and protocols for seamless communication between systems. This includes defining data exchange methods and system interactions.
Implementation and Configuration: The implementation phase involves setting up the integration framework, configuring various systems, and ensuring that all components work together as intended. Careful coordination and thorough testing are essential to ensure successful integration.
Testing and Validation: Comprehensive testing is critical to validate the integration and ensure it meets performance and reliability standards. This includes functional testing, performance assessment, and user acceptance testing.
Ongoing Support and Maintenance: Post-implementation support is crucial for addressing any issues and ensuring the continued smooth operation of integrated systems. Regular maintenance and updates are necessary to keep the system efficient and up-to-date.
Real-World Applications
Industrial Automation: In manufacturing, Control Integration Services streamline operations by integrating process control systems, safety systems, and enterprise resource planning (ERP) systems. This integration enhances production efficiency and minimizes downtime.
Building Management Systems (BMS): For commercial buildings, integrating HVAC, lighting, and security systems into a single BMS platform improves energy efficiency and operational control. This results in better resource management and reduced operational costs.
IT and Data Centers: In IT environments, Control Integration Services help manage data center operations, including server monitoring, network management, and security. Integrated systems ensure efficient, reliable, and secure IT infrastructure.
